In the Indonesia sulfate of potash market, the import trend exhibited notable growth from 2023 to 2024, with a growth rate of 13.52%. The compound annual growth rate (CAGR) for imports from 2020 to 2024 stood at 31.62%. This growth can be attributed to a notable demand shift towards sulfate of potash products in the Indonesian market, likely influenced by changing agricultural practices or increased awareness of the product`s benefits.
